High-speed optical communication Li-Fi

15.06.2013

Li-Fi, short for Light Fidelity, is an optical wireless technology developed and presented by Harald Haas at the 2011 TED Talk. The French company Oledcomm announced that the first communication devices of its production, based on Li-Fi technology, will be available on the market next year.

Li-Fi technology works by binary modulating light from a special LED source. Modulation is carried out at a high frequency, and the transceiver itself in appearance is no different from an ordinary LED light bulb for household lighting.

Receiving sensors connected to computers or other digital electronic devices allow you to receive information when they are exposed to direct light from a Li-Fi source. This imposes some restrictions on the use of this technology, but in the end, such optical communication is somewhat safer than traditional Wi-Fi, the signals of which can be intercepted from anywhere within the range of the equipment. In order to intercept information transmitted via Li-Fi, an attacker will need to place his spy equipment literally on your lap, which can lead to serious difficulties for him.

In addition to the above, Li-Fi optical wireless technology can be used without restriction in places where the use of equipment that emits extraneous radio waves that may interfere with the normal operation of critical equipment is prohibited. Such places, of course, include intensive care wards of medical institutions, aircraft cabins and some other places.

At present, the information transfer rate that Li-Fi technology can provide is slightly higher than the speed of traditional Wi-Fi. Oledcomm representatives report that they have managed to obtain a stable information transfer rate of about 3 Gb / s, and a transfer rate of 10 Gb / s will be achieved in the very near future.

Alcohol content of warm beer 07.05.2024

Beer, as one of the most common alcoholic drinks, has its own unique taste, which can change depending on the temperature of consumption. A new study by an international team of scientists has found that beer temperature has a significant impact on the perception of alcoholic taste. The study, led by materials scientist Lei Jiang, found that at different temperatures, ethanol and water molecules form different types of clusters, which affects the perception of alcoholic taste. At low temperatures, more pyramid-like clusters form, which reduces the pungency of the "ethanol" taste and makes the drink taste less alcoholic. On the contrary, as the temperature increases, the clusters become more chain-like, resulting in a more pronounced alcoholic taste. AMD FirePro W4300 Graphics Card 03.12.2015

AMD introduced the AMD FirePro W4300 graphics card for computer-aided design (CAD) systems, which can be installed in both compact workstations (SFF) and tower cases. The AMD FirePro W4300 combines a GPU and 4GB of GDDR5 memory in a low-profile board, making it suitable for both SFF and full-size systems. Now organizations can simplify the process of managing their IT assets by choosing the same high-performance graphics solution for all types of workstations, the company stressed.

The AMD FirePro W4300 professional graphics card is optimized for the latest CAD applications including Autodesk AutoCAD, Inventor and Revit, Dassault Systemes Solidworks and CATIA, PTC Creo, Siemens NX and many more. Engineering professionals can work with large geometric models using GPU acceleration mechanisms for their projects, such as the new Order Independent Transparency (OIT) mode in Solidworks. Users have the opportunity to increase their productivity by visualizing workflows on 6 displays, as well as working with resolutions up to 4K and even 5K.
